\This may also be caused by Gnome options about media, where an option is
\selected to auto-mount certain types of media and the mounter needs to
\check the device every so often and see if there is a media and what
\kind it is, you can get a "seek zero, read" in the middle of a series of
\writes, resulting in an attempt to write over an already-written sector.

After a failed attempt to write, I find the system is longer seeing a blank disk
until I manually remount the disk, so it is not very likely that the system is
continuously checking the drive and causes problems.
